New trailer for Pixar’s ‘The Good Dinosaur’ features talking dinos (Video)

Disney and Pixar released a new trailer last week, showing off talking dinosaurs in The Good Dinosaur. The troubled production will be Pixar’s second movie of 2015.

The trailer, released on Oct. 6, follows the really cool first trailer, which focused on the visuals, This new one reveals the story, which does seem a bit similar to many other Pixar movies.

We have Arlo (Raymond Ochoa) getting separated from his family and goes on an adventure with a human boy named Spot (Jack Bright), who behaves more like a dog. That’s because dinosaurs were not killed by an asteroid in this universe and instead lived to roam the earth.

Other voices include Jeffrey Wright, Frances McDormand, Sam Elliott, Anna Paquin, Marcus Scribner, AJ Buckley and Jack Bright.

In June, Disney announced a whole new voice cast for the film, which was just the latest hiccup for the production. Up co-director Bob Peterson left, only to be replaced by Peter Sohn.

The Good Dinosaur hits theaters on Nov. 25, 2015. That means this is the first year with two Pixar movies, as Inside Out was a big hit this summer.
